Cyme
[saim]
Definition
(noun.) more or less flat-topped cluster of flowers in which the central or terminal flower opens first.

Definition
(n.) A flattish or convex flower cluster, of the centrifugal or determinate type, differing from a corymb chiefly in the order of the opening of the blossoms.

Definition
n. a young shoot: (bot.) term applied to all forms of inflorescence which are definite or centrifugal.—adjs. Cym′oid Cym′ose Cym′ous.
